My sense is that #inclusion is being misunderstood atm. It's not about expecting everyone to fit into a one size fits all system then adjusting when they don't. It's about creating an environment that includes everyone through making adjustments ahead of time. Start by thinking about the outliers. 🙏🏻

Girls in Afghanistan have lost basic human rights. A young woman who escaped the Taliban, Nadia Nadim, reached Denmark as a refugee, became a proffesional footballer, playing for PSG, Man City & represented Denmark 99 times. She speaks 11 languages & has just qualified as a doctor.... #AfghanWomen

The biggest change in reproductive rights in Britain in half a century has just passed the Commons.
MPs have voted 379-137 to decriminalise abortion, preventing women from being prosecuted for terminating a pregnancy after 24 weeks.
